Abstract

The Sieverts’ constant of tritium in eutectic lithium-lead (PbLi) is of high importance for future fusion applications, where PbLi is one option for the breeding of tritium in the breeding blanket. Currently, literature reports Sieverts’ constant measurements with a spread of more than two orders of magnitude for eutectic PbLi. Additionally, there is only little data available for measurements actually using tritium, but mostly extrapolations from hydrogen or deuterium. With the setup presented in this publication, we try to address the lack of available tritium data for the Sieverts’ constant of eutectic PbLi as well as aiming for a robust and reliable measurement of all necessary parameters, including a cleaning procedure. This is paramount for the selection of promising breeding blanket technologies.
